A "victualer" is a supplier of victuals, a sutler, or, nautically, a supply ship. Primarily in British English, it refers to an innkeeper.

Front | victualer also victualler \VIT-l-uhr\ |
---|---|
Back | noun 1. A supplier of victuals; a sutler. 2. Chiefly British. An innkeeper. 3. Nautical. A supply ship. "Philip Morris, whose Kraft General Foods is top Yankee victualer on the global scene, recorded $9.4 billion in food salesabroad last year." |
